The University of Leeds acceptance rate is 64-77%.Do Leeds accept lower grades?
Access to Leeds could offer you the chance to study a degree with lower entry requirements than listed on our course pages. This can be two grades lower than the published entry requirement for each course. So for example, if the course entry requirement is AAA - the Access to Leeds offer could be ABB.What is the lowest rated university in UK?

The University of Leeds is one of the largest higher education institutions in the UK, with more than 38,000 students from more than 150 different countries. Founded in 1904, it is renowned globally for the quality of its teaching and research.Is Leeds a good University town?

The University is famous for its social opportunities, with its Student Union being the only one in the country to have won two gold standards in the Student Union Evaluation Initiative, and there are over 300 different clubs and societies to join.Is Leeds expensive for students?
Leeds is an affordable city and home to three top-class universities in the UK. On average, as a student, you can estimate your cost of living will be around £805 – £1280 per month.
